Extension Springs

Extension springs are mechanical components designed to absorb and store energy by resisting pulling forces or tension. Unlike compression springs that act under compressive loads, extension springs stretch to generate a counteracting force. These springs are versatile and commonly used in various applications requiring precise tension control. Extension springs are engineered to offer resistance when extended. They store energy as the spring is stretched from its free length and return to its original state upon load removal.

Miniature Extension Springs

Miniature extension springs are small, tightly wound helical springs designed to operate with tension. They stretch to provide a pulling force between two components and return to their original shape when the force is released. These springs are engineered for precision applications where space is limited but reliable tension is required.
